Changing the USB Port Protocol

You can use the procedure below to change the USB
communication protocol that is used when exchanging data with
a computer, printer, or other external device. Select the protocol
that suits the device to which you are connecting.
1.
Press [MENU].
2.
On the "Set Up" tab, select "USB" and then
press [ ].
B
3.
Use [ ] and [ ] to select the setting you want
and then press [SET].
When you want to connect to this type
of device:
Computer or a printer that supports USB
DIRECT-PRINT (page 192)
With this setting, the computer sees the
camera as an external storage device.
Use this setting for normal transfer of
images from the camera to a computer
(using the bundled Photo Loader with
HOT ALBUM application).
Printer that supports PictBridge (page
192)
This setting simplifies the transfer of
image data to the connected device.
